    what size pods for cv32 carbs?

    alright, just got new carbs from ebay for my bike,80 gs750et. they are the original set of carbs for the tscc engine(cv32). i now need to buy pod filters for it, so what size pods do i need for it(in mm)? and where is the cheapest place to get them? thanks for all the help! [/img]

    #2
    Well, I believe mine were the 54mm ones. I got them off of ebay.
    You are going to rejet...arent you?

        #4
        rejet

        yes, i am going to rejet, i had a set of vm29ss aftermarket mikinu's on the bike before, but could never get the carbs tuned to the engine, i think the throttle bodys had the wrong cutout on it(1.5 instead of 2.5). so i bought used cv carbs off of ebay for $52 + $12 dollars shipping and have rebuilt with new gaskets and internals. i have a CRAP load of main jets from trying to tune the the vm29's.
        I have 100,102.5,110,112.5,115,122.5,127.5

        which jets should i start with?

          Lets see...you have pods right? That's 2.5 sizes up right there.
          If you have a 4-into-1 exhaust too that's another 2.5 sizes.
          That would put you at using a 115 mikuni main jet.
